The 1881 Census reveals a detailed snapshot of households in England, Wales and Scotland. The census was taken on April 3rd and the total population was recorded as 29,707,207.
In the 1881 Census, the household of David Wallace, born in 1836 in Kilwinning, Ayrshire, consisted of 3 members. David was the head of the household, married to John Wallace, born in 1849 in Glasgow, Lanarkshire, Scotland.
During the period, also present in the household was David's Servant, Jessie Eyvel, born in 1870 in Dufftown, Banffshire, Scotland.
